DEEN, Judge.
The plaintiff appellant, on the way home from her doctor's office, was riding in a taxi which came almost to a stop at an intersection; the defendant's vehicle, also moving slowly, struck it from the rear. The plaintiff's body hit no part of the automobile. The taxi driver took her back to the doctor's office where she was given a prescription for pain; however, her subsequent testimony indicates that she took nothing stonger than aspirin.
